> Solr JMX monitoring agent is throwing InvalidClassException when trying to deserialize AlreadyClosedException thrown by Solr during JMX stat fetching.
> Stack trace:
> org.apache.lucene.store.AlreadyClosedException; local class incompatible: stream classdesc serialVersionUID = 5608155941692732578, local class serialVersionUID = -1978883495828278874"
> java.rmi.UnmarshalException: Error unmarshaling return; nested exception is: 
>     java.io.InvalidClassException: org.apache.lucene.store.AlreadyClosedException; local class incompatible: stream classdesc serialVersionUID = 5608155941692732578, local class serialVersionUID = -1978883495828278874"
> The serialVersionUID value computed by java at runtime changed when a new constructor was added with a 'cause' field.
> AlreadyClosedExceptions can be thrown by the MBean server if a remote instance is trying to access stats on a recently deleted core for instance. In this case, the exception is serialized/deserialized by the MBean handler which can cause InvalidClassExceptions if the monitoring service is using a different version of lucene. Since Lucene doesn't want to implement Serializable, these exceptions should be propagated up to the MBeanServer.
